Usama B. looks like a good fit?

We can organize an interview with Aldin or any of our 25,000 available candidates within 48 hours. How would you like to proceed?

Schedule Interview Now

Usama B. Cloud, Modern Frameworks and DevOps Platforms

My name is Usama B. and I have over 9 years of experience in the tech industry. I specialize in the following technologies: Google Cloud, Cloud Run, Kubernetes, Terraform, Amazon Web Services, etc.. I hold a degree in Bachelor of Science (BS), High school degree. Some of the notable projects I’ve worked on include: Fully responsive React website for E-commerce store, NestJS boilerplate - Open source contribution, Berriot - Consumer IoT Visualization and Alerting Platform, Nvista - IoT Based Power & Energy Solution. I am based in Karachi, Pakistan. I've successfully completed 4 projects while developing at Softaims.

I employ a methodical and structured approach to solution development, prioritizing deep domain understanding before execution. I excel at systems analysis, creating precise technical specifications, and ensuring that the final solution perfectly maps to the complex business logic it is meant to serve.

My tenure at Softaims has reinforced the importance of careful planning and risk mitigation. I am skilled at breaking down massive, ambiguous problems into manageable, iterative development tasks, ensuring consistent progress and predictable delivery schedules.

I strive for clarity and simplicity in both my technical outputs and my communication. I believe that the most powerful solutions are often the simplest ones, and I am committed to finding those elegant answers for our clients.

Main technologies

  • Cloud, Modern Frameworks and DevOps Platforms

    9 years

  • Google Cloud

    2 Years

  • Cloud Run

    2 Years

  • Kubernetes

    6 Years

Additional skills

Direct hire

Potentially possible

Previous Company

Techlogix

Ready to get matched with vetted developers fast?

Let's get started today!

Hire Remote Developer

Experience Highlights

Fully responsive React website for E-commerce store

Portfolio Project: E-Commerce Store Website Overview: Created a dynamic and fully responsive e-commerce website using ReactJS, offering an exceptional user experience across various devices. Achievements: Developed an intuitive interface ensuring optimal user experience on any device. Achieved a lightning-fast load time of under 3 seconds for enhanced user engagement. Utilized AWS S3, Route 53, CloudFront, and Certificate Manager for secure and scalable hosting. Technologies: Frontend: ReactJS Cloud Services: AWS (S3, Route 53, CloudFront, Certificate Manager) Impact: The project showcases expertise in ReactJS, performance optimization, and AWS deployment, resulting in a high-performing, globally accessible e-commerce platform. Result: A seamlessly responsive and performant website, providing a top-notch online shopping experience, backed by secure and scalable AWS infrastructure.

NestJS boilerplate - Open source contribution

Easy to use and dynamic NestJS boilerplate, helps quickly start working on a project with best practices and reduces time in developing the most obvious utilities in a project This is an open-source contribution from myself. The goal was to make a simple boilerplate that allows any developer to clone and start working on his/her own Nest.JS project, hence it includes the following: - MongoDB connection - Environment variables - Dynamic application logger - Centralized helper function module - Module-wise constant variables - Generic API response object with pagination and errors (to be used application-wide) - Sample weather module with crud operations that can be inspired to create other feature modules according to your use case - ESLint and prettier extension configs - launch.json, so you can easily debug the application on vscode I have also written a medium article which describes all the components of this project

Berriot - Consumer IoT Visualization and Alerting Platform

Consumer IoT Visualization and Alerting Platform – Web Application Duration: July 2019 - Present Environment: Node.js, Express, React, DynamoDB, AWS IoT Core, JIRA Outline: A platform empowers enterprises to build applications for millions of devices with real-time visualization, device management, data import/export, and analytics capabilities, enabling dynamic experiences and customized IoT reports. The application is developed on the Javascript stack (Node, Express, React) and uses AWS-managed services such as IoT core, SQS, SES, Lambda, EC2, Cognito etc. For data storage, it uses NoSQL AWS DynamoDB. It also includes complete user management (using AWS Cognito) and RBAC. The web interface is built on react using ant design and includes charting libraries such as ant chart & chart.js. Agile model with Scrum methodology. Jira was used as a project management and issue-tracking tool. Responsibilities: Co-Founder - Gathering requirements, managing cloud resources, overlooking frontend development, and managing deployments Complete backend development using Node.js Designed and developed data manipulation and data aggregation layer on serverless architecture (FaaS) Database design and optimization on AWS DynamoDB Developed user management and RBAC using AWS Cognito - keeping security and industry best practices in mind Overlooking the team of frontend (React) developers Managing AWS IoT core and making modifications as per customer requirements

Nvista - IoT Based Power & Energy Solution

IoT Based Power & Energy Solution – Web Application Duration: July 2020 - March 2021 Environment: Node.js, Express, React, DynamoDB, AWS IoT Core, JIRA Outline: A solution designed for visualization, monitoring and management of IoT based HVAC systems. The data is captured every 1 minute and is sanitized and stored in a scalable NoSQL database. A serverless application layer processes the data and intelligently calculates energy consumed by individual devices. The application is developed on the Javascript stack (Node, Express, React) and uses AWS managed services such as IoT core, SQS, SES, Lambda, EC2, Cognito etc. For data storage it uses NoSQL AWS DynamoDB. It also includes complete user management (using AWS Cognito) and RBAC. Web interface is built on react using ant design and includes charting libraries such as ant chart & chart.js. Agile model with Scrum methodology. Jira was used as a project management and issue tracking tool. Responsibilities: Team lead - Gathering requirements, managing cloud resources, overlooking on frontend development and managing deployments Complete backend development using Node.js Designed and developed data manipulation and data aggregation layer on serverless architecture (FaaS) Database design and optimization on AWS DynamoDB - such that the total monthly bill of database was less than 5$ Developed user management and RBAC using AWS Cognito - keeping security and industry best practices in mind Overlooking the team of frontend (React) developers Managing AWS IoT core and making modifications as per requirements

Education

  • DHA Suffa University

    Bachelor of Science (BS) in Computer science

    2014-01-01-2018-01-01

  • DJ Sindh Government Science College

    High school degree in Pre Engineering

    2012-01-01-2014-01-01

Languages

  • English